See how RHS can give expert advice on growing, feeding, pruning and propagating plants. ‘John Creech’ grows 3 to 6 inches tall and with a 12-inch-wide spread. 'Red Cauli' _ 'Red Cauli' is a bushy, mound-forming perennial with dark purple stems bearing fleshy, ovate to oblong, purple-flushed, dark blue-green leaves and terminal clusters of small, ruby-red flowers from late summer into autumn. There are 3 varieties of sedum plants: Tall border varieties (Hylotelephium or Sedum telephium) with dense, domed flowers and succulent leaves on 1- to 2-foot stems. It will spread quickly, as leaves will take root on any surface they are touching. Sedum requires well-draining soil; it is susceptible to rot due to too much moisture. Standing for months, their faded flowers and seed heads provide a colorful display in late fall and winter, even under snow caps. Red-leaved creeping sedum cultivars "Red Carpet" and ”Dragon’s Blood" handle climates across U.S. Department of Agriculture plant hardiness zones 3 through 8. How to Grow Sedum spurium Plants Guide to Growing Two-row Stonecrop (stonecrop, Creeping Red Sedum, Tricolor Stonecrop, Red-leaved Sedum) Sedum spurium is an herbaceous semi-evergreen plant that is commonly referred to as Two-row Stonecrop.
